Transaction 43f3d27750c88db184a075161806809097eb50266342dd70a5c33ae8f38bbef9

2 Input
2 Outputs
  • 43f3d27750c88db184a075161806809097eb50266342dd70a5c33ae8f38bbef9:0
  • value  848122
    address  3FpbgNkVdV8jjr5z2nZAFyUGaJNy2fcAbR
  • 43f3d27750c88db184a075161806809097eb50266342dd70a5c33ae8f38bbef9:1
  • value  746774
    address  bc1qsl6v9zqq2p85ssxhsmxwagc8rhcv0evkuscq9e